Oliseh “Proud” After Fortuna Sittard Draw Vs Besiktas

Image

Fortuna Sittard’s Nigerian manager Sunday Oliseh is proud of his side’s 3-3 draw against Turkish champions Besiktas in Sunday’s pre-season friendly in Istanbul, Completesportsnigeria.com reports.

Besiktas took the lead through Sedat Sahintürk but Lisandro Semedo who is on trial at Dutch second-tier side Fortuna restored parity for the club few minutes later.

In the second half, new signing André Vidigal gave Fortuna Sittard the lead just after the hour mark but the joy was short-lived three minutes later by Atiba Hutchinson who equalised for the Turkish giants.

Caner Erkin scored what looked like the winner for Besiktas in the 80th minute only for Jorrit Smeets to earn the Dutch side a share of the spoils in stoppage time.

After the game Oliseh took to his Twitter handle to express his delight at his players’ display during the game.

“In Istanbul Besiktas complex after an honourable 3-3 draw with Besiktas. Pre-season friendly match with Fortuna Sittard. Proud of my players,” former Nigeria captain and head coach Oliseh tweeted along with a picture of himself having a meal with Fortuna Sittard colleagues.

​​Fortuna will play their last friendly match in Turkey against Iranian side ZOB Ahan FC on Tuesday.

​​Fortuna ​Sittard ​kick off their Eerste Divisie campaign with a home game against Dordrecht on the 8th of August.

Oliseh Equals Van Marwijk’s Coaching Record At Sittard
Oliseh Equals Van Marwijk’s Coaching Record At Sittard

August 25, 2017 at 12:07

sunday-editedFortuna Sittard is slowly setting up under Coach Sunday Oliseh. The Limburgers have even reached the highest point average since 1980 under a trainer who has the team at least for twenty-one games in charge.

For the first time since 1998/99 the Limburgers (Fortuna Sittard) have won five home duels in a row,Oliseh therefore equalswith Bert van Marwijk’s performance. It is true that Van Marwijk put up that series in the Eredivisie. In that season, the Limburgers were also twice as strong for Ajax, where Oliseh played both times at the time.

The victory vs FC Dordrecht (5-1) brings Fortuna Sittard to the top of the Jupiler League table. On February 7, 2014, a margin of at least four was reached in an official duel when Telstar were defeated with 5-0.

After twenty matches in service at Fortuna Sittard, Oliseh scored the highest point average (1.65 per duel) and profit percentage (45 percent) of all trainers who had coached the club at least for a similar period since 1980, according to Opta Sports. The seventeenth place in the ranking of last season seems to be surpassed on this foot.
